French Foreign Minister: Sanctions may be imposed on Israel for delivery of humanitarian aid to Gaza

France's Foreign Minister Stephane Sejourne said on Tuesday that pressure, and possibly sanctions, must be imposed on Israel to open crossings to get humanitarian aid to Palestinians in Gaza, Report informs via Reuters.
"There must be levers of influence and there are multiple levers, going up to sanctions to let humanitarian aid cross check points," Stephane Sejourne told RFI radio and France 24 television.
